ResearchCuprins
1. What Do We Know About Protein Synthesis?.- 2. Structure and Function of Phage RNA: A Summary of Current Knowledge.- 3. Host Proteins in the Replication of Bacteriophage RNA.- 4. On the Regulation of RNA Synthesis in Escherichia coli.- 5. Interconvertible Forms of Bacterial RNA Polymerase.- 6. Visualization of Genetic Transcription.- 7. Structural and Functional Studies on Mammalian Nuclear DNA-Dependent RNA Polymerases.- 8. Regulation of Nucleolar DNA-Dependent RNA Polymerase by Amino Acids in Ehrlich Ascites Tumor Cells.- 9. Rhynchosciara angelae Salivary Gland DNA: Kinetic Complexity and Transcription of Repetitive Sequences.- 10. Hormonal Regulation of Ovalbumin Synthesis in Chick Oviduct.- 11. mRNA Synthesis in Erythropoiesis: Specific Effect of Erythropoietin on the Synthesis of DNA-like RNA.- 12. Messenger RNA: Its Origin and Fate in Mammalian Cells.- 13. Messenger RNA Processing in Vertebrate Cells.- 14. Effects of Neonatal Thyroidectomy on Nuclear and Microsomal RNA Synthesis in Developing Rat Brain.- 15. Structure—Function Relations in tRNA.- 16. Nucleotide Sequence and Function of Transfer RNA and Precursor Transfer RNA.- 17. Changes in Specificity of Suppression in Transfer Ribonucleic Acid Mutants.- 18. Conformational States of Transfer Ribonucleic Acids.- 19. Modification of Leucine tRNA of Escherichia coli After Bacteriophage T4 Infection.- 20. Reconstitution of 50S Ribosomal Subunits and the Role of 5S RNA.- 21. Electron Microscopic Studies of Escherichia coli Ribosomal Subunits.- 22. Aggregation Properties of Rat Liver Ribosomes.- 23. Studies on Hela Cell Nucleoli.- 24. On the Movement of the Ribosome Along the Messenger Ribonucleic Acid and on Apparent Changes in Ribosome Configuration During Protein Synthesis.- 25. Initiation of DNA Synthesis byOligoribonucleotides.- 26. “Enzymatic” and “Nonenzymatic” Translation.- 27. The Ribosome Cycle in Bacteria.- 28. Antibiotic Action in Protein Synthesis.- 29. Mechanisms of Mammalian Protein Synthesis.- 30. The Effect of Sodium Fluoride, Edeine, and Cycloheximide on Peptide Synthesis with Reticulocyte Ribosomes.- 31. Intermediate Stages in the Ribosomal Cycle of Reticulocytes.- 32. Studies on the Binding of Aminoacyl-tRNA to Wheat Ribosomes.- 33. Polymerization Factors in Yeast.- 34. Modifications of Polysome-Associated RNA After Poliovirus Infection.- 35. On the Relationship Between Transcription, Translation, and Ribosomal RNA Synthesis During Microsomal Hydroxylase Induction.- 36. Ribosomes in Reticulocyte Maturation.- 37. Hormonal Mechanisms in Regulation of Gene Expression.- 38. Synthesis of Mitochondrial Proteins.- 39. Stimulation of the Synthesis of Inner Mitochondrial Membrane Proteins in Rat Liver by Cuprizone.- 40. Hormonal Effects on Mitochondrial Protein Synthesis.
